"Lucidor is a computer program for reading and handling
e-books. Lucidor supports e-books in the EPUB file format, and
catalogs in the OPDS format. Lucidor runs on the GNU/Linux, Windows
and Mac OS X platforms.
"Lucidor Features
"Lucidor provides functionality to
* Read EPUB e-books.
* Organize a collection of e-books in a local bookcase.
* Search for and download e-books from the Internet, for example by
browsing OPDS catalogs.
* Convert web feeds into e-books."
